                                                             BACK TO REALITY

                           I’m determined to become better at flying. I rented some space for practicing. It’s private enough so I don’t get distracted by other people.

                             You have to be patient and confident in order to succeed. You start running in a simple rhythm. When you think you’re ready, stretch your arms in front of you and leap into the air. If you assume it right, you will start gliding. But if your concentration is off, you will end up lying smashed on the ground.

                               I have no trouble flying. I decide to hitch a ride to town to show off my new skills to the citizens. I beg a ride with a trucker and ask to be dropped a mile away.                                                       “You still have a long walk ahead of you. Are you sure you don’t want me to drive you the rest of the way to town?” he asks.

“No thanks. I’m going to fly.”

                                      He stares at me strangely, but I don’t care. Everyone will know what I can do, in a bit of time.  Soon I’m soaring across, swooping down, occasionally, to show off. Cars beep at me, and people holler. I’m creating quite a commotion.

                                    A business man glares up at me, “What are you doing?” I answer, “Why! Isn’t it obvious? I’m flying!” After a while, I, bored and tired, land back down.

                                    Just around the corner, I overhear a homeless family murmuring, “He's been running around town with his arms out, telling people he can fly. He almost got hit by cars a couple times while running across the streets. He's a danger to himself and others."                                I can’t believe it. They think I am crazy! Or maybe I am. Was I really just delusional? Thinking I was flying when I was just running on the ground? But it seemed so real!
